About Michel Vounatsos

Michel Vounatsos, CEO of Biogen, has been a central figure in discussions around the company's Alzheimer's disease drug aducanumab. Following the FDA's approval of the drug in June 2021, Vounatsos described it as a "historic day" and said it provided "hope finally for the patients and families" after nearly two decades without a new treatment for the disease. He noted that the accelerated approval pathway is a well-established process used by the FDA and stated that the company is committed to continuing to study the product. In earlier appearances, Vounatsos discussed the company's decision to seek FDA approval for the drug after initially discontinuing trials, attributing the reversal to new data showing that a "sufficient and sustained high dose" of the drug could remove amyloid plaques. Vounatsos has also spoken about Biogen's environmental initiatives, announcing a 20-year plan called "Healthy Climate Healthy Lives" with a goal of eliminating fossil fuel emissions by 2040. He stated that "the pharma industry... can't lead in health without reducing our operational impact on the planet" and argued that climate solutions should also promote human health. On drug pricing, Vounatsos has called for the industry to be proactive, suggesting the adoption of innovative contracts that require payers to share risk, and has said Biogen aims to be the "Tesla" of the drug pricing model. He has also expressed a vision for a shift toward personalized medicine and preventative care, and identified neurodegenerative diseases as a priority area for the company.

Some say the best predictor of the future is the past. Yet in 1970, I believe it would have been very difficult to predict the remarkable progress we're observing today. As we celebrate the last 50 years of biopharmaceutical achievements, it's important to think back to the 1970s and reflect on our progress and our priorities. In his 1969 congressional testimony, the U.S. Surgeon General William Stewart claimed, quote, 'The time has come to close the book on infectious diseases,' close quote, and that antibiotics and vaccines would win the war on this class of disease. He obviously did not perceive the threatening pathogens that began to emerge even in the 1970s, including Lyme disease, Lassa fever, Legionnaires' disease, and antibiotic-resistant bacteria. Then in later years, HIV, SARS, Ebola virus, Zika, etc., leading to our current SARS-CoV-2 pandemic. 50 years later, clearly the era of infectious diseases is far from over. What Surgeon General Stewart did recognize was that we needed to focus more attention on chronic diseases, including cancer, heart disease, and diabetes. This led to President Nixon's announcement of the War on Cancer in 1970. The focus on cancer therapeutics and the $500 million investment in the National Cancer Institute catalyzed a series of basic discoveries about oncogenesis in the 1970s that were translated into new treatment approaches like cyclosporine, more powerful radiation therapy, combination treatments, and autologous bone marrow transplantation. This era also ushered in the era of biotechnology with the advent of recombinant DNA technology, monoclonal antibodies, and the launch of the first biotechnology company, Genentech, in 1976, a company that I think Sue Desmond-Hellmann knows a little bit about. The discovery of reverse transcriptase and the link between cancer and viruses created new insights which proved to be critical a decade later when the HIV pandemic emerged. And of course, we're still building on that foundational work today as we create vaccines to combat SARS-CoV-2. Though we haven't yet won that war on cancer or infectious diseases, the steady achievements of biopharmaceutical innovations over the past 50 years have accelerated our progress and saved countless lives around the world. These progressive achievements are the source of the optimism I feel about our ability to contain the current pandemic and are certainly cause for celebration. Unfortunately, there is one challenge where progress over the past 50 years has been far too slow: we still struggle to achieve equitable access to our innovations at a national or global level. Unless we take collective action to not only ensure our vaccines and treatments reach all the people who need them, but also champion the longer-term policy and societal changes necessary to redress systemic inequalities and particularly health disparities, we won't be able to claim success.

I'm going to speak from the perspective of academic medical centers, which are deeply devoted to scientific discovery and research and are firmly committed to translating these discoveries into advances which will benefit patients. The COVID-19 pandemic has undoubtedly accelerated the pace of change in just about all aspects of our lives, but especially in scientific innovation and the practice of clinical medicine. At our academic medical centers, we have quickly learned to manage a new disease in creative ways that we absolutely didn't know about one year ago. We have shifted our research focus to innovate in new technologies to address COVID-19, and these technologies have been rapidly translated to the care of our patients. And this includes very simple techniques in terms of how do you maneuver a ventilator, how do you position a patient to ensure adequate oxygenation—very simple things that have made huge differences in the lives of our patients. And we've also partnered with biotech and pharma to test new vaccines and therapeutics. We've learned to be more focused, disciplined, and efficient, and this disruptive change on how we do our business is our new normal. And perhaps we can come back to that during the discussion period. While much has changed, there are several constants that have not. The first is the fundamental strength of our life sciences ecosystem, and by that I mean the partnership between academic medicine, venture capital, biotech, and pharma. The pipeline whereby scientific discoveries often made at academic medical centers and funded through NIH research are spun out, developed, and marketed through industry partnerships remains intact, but we must nurture it and grow it. A second and equally important variable that hasn't changed is the brilliant talent of our young physicians and scientists in training who want to commit their life's work to scientific discovery and therapeutic advances to benefit our patients in a variety of ways and in a variety of sectors. So our challenges going forward are multiple: how do we continue to fund basic and clinical research? How do we harness the remarkable talent of our young people in their training? How do we ensure that we are inclusive to the broader group of individuals who will make scientific contributions but may have been left out because of educational opportunities not available to them due to systemic racism? How do we not allow government policy to overregulate, denounce, and get in the way of scientific innovation? And how do we allow market forces to build the capital necessary to expand our innovation pipeline? So finally, what am I most excited about and think will build value over the next 50 years? I'm going to put something out on the table for us to discuss, and I'm going to say I believe firmly that gene and cell-based therapies are going to be one of the major, if not the major, innovative platform over the next 50 years. And by gene and cell-based therapies, I mean DNA and RNA-based therapeutics, cell-based treatments including T-cell therapies, nucleic acid aptamers, and other approaches to regenerative medicine. We've only begun to realize the potential of these new therapeutic platforms. For example, I'm sure you've discussed earlier in this forum the speed of RNA vaccines from genomic sequence identification to vaccine candidate development to clinical testing has really defied all scientific norms. We have yet to unleash the full potential of our genomic therapeutics for rare and common diseases, and several that I'm particularly excited about are the approaches to the genetic hemoglobinopathies such as sickle cell and thalassemia. I was just going to say, Betsy, one of the things I've read is that as soon as the pandemic kind of decreased in intensity, people went back to seeing their clinicians. What's been your observation on telemedicine and the impact of the pandemic on your staff?
B
Betsy Nabel21:44
Telemedicine has had a huge impact on our practice of medicine across academic and community hospitals. During the height of COVID here in New England, which was March, April, May, we rapidly converted all of our ambulatory visits to being telemedicine. That was in part because our governor required us to shut down our ambulatory and elective care procedures, but we rapidly ramped up to converting all ambulatory visits to telemedicine. Fortunately, we had the electronic medical record and digital applications in place so that we could do that very quickly. I would say that since the spring, over the course of the summer, as we've opened up our facilities, we have reverted back to some clinical care programs obviously we need to for a variety of urgent care and procedures, but our patients are still using digital technology to access their primary care physicians, their nurse practitioners, as the first entree into the health system, both for prevention as well as screening, routine care, medication prescription refills, et cetera. So right now, I would say at the peak we were 70% virtual, 30% in person. We're now about 50-50, and we think the virtual is absolutely going to continue. The partnership for us is really we can't innovate all of the digital applications or all of the AI usage in-house, and so even though we've got really incredible bright millennials and Gen Xers, we can't do it all ourselves. So we really do need to partner, and we're doing that primarily through a number of startup digital companies that'll come in and build on our technology platforms to really build out our patient care access.

But coming back to the broader question about artificial intelligence and information technology, I'm really optimistic, not just because of what we've seen recently. But if we take a step back and think about the business model of these companies over time, R&D productivities continue to decline and the cost of developing a new drug has gone up. At Merck, we spend essentially 21 cents on every dollar of revenue that gets plowed back into R&D for future drugs. And so it's imperative to find new ways to enable and streamline drug development so we can develop affordable medicines in a timely fashion and deliver them to the people who need them, and I mean people all over the world, not just people in advanced economies like the United States. And that's where I think advances in data capture and digital technologies, artificial intelligence, may help develop new and improved and hopefully minimally invasive methods to provide physiological and biochemical activities within the body, and the ability to capture large amounts of data hopefully will allow us to interrogate them to find correlations and therapeutic insights that will have the potential to transform how we conduct clinical trials, again with the goal of evaluating these medicines with fewer individuals, particularly earlier in the discovery and development continuum.

Maybe I could change the topic for a moment to the pandemic that we're currently going through. I think most scientists predict that this probably isn't the last one, and there are some important lessons to be learned. One of which was how strikingly unprepared we were in many ways. And so if you look at the next 50 years and you look at the suffering and the economic devastation that's come from this, we hope we can be better prepared. But if you look at our health system the way it's constructed now and all the sectors that participate in it, for instance, Betsy, you're running a hospital system. We've had now three decades of trying to make health care as efficient as possible, to the point that not a hospital has an extra doctor or nurse in a hospital in America. This is the opposite of how you have to prepare for a pandemic, right? You need extra equipment in the storerooms, you need things stockpiled. If we had reservists the way the army does, reservist doctors, reservist nurses, that would have been a big help. You have to pay for things that you probably won't use, like take a gamble on whether we need an antiviral or we need a vaccine and that particular pathogen may never get to us and never be used. So you basically have two different business models, I think: one for day-to-day health care for the whole country, and a different one to be prepared to handle a pandemic. And the second one just hasn't been developed. What are your thoughts about what we need to do in either our business model or government intervention, or what do we really need to do with the kinds of expertise and resources the three of you represent to be prepared over the next decade or so?
K
Ken Frazier31:47
Well, my own view, Mike, is that we haven't developed a global pandemic preparedness effort. And I know Sue, you've been engaged in some of the international efforts, and I'm sure my panelists would say we've had false starts, we've put our foot in the water, but we've never come together as a collective global community to do this. And I'm far from being the expert in this to know what's the best way to proceed, but I often wonder if we shouldn't just let the private sector begin to organize this and come together. When you think about the toll on our businesses across this country and internationally, my guess is it would require a relatively small sum of money for the private sector to come together and contribute into a global pandemic preparedness program. I think even though we're a non-for-profit, I think it's something that our healthcare system would rapidly invest in. But again, I'm not expert, I don't know the best way to go about that, but I simply put that out that private sector organization may be the route to go. Maybe it's a public-private partnership.
B
Betsy Nabel33:02
I think it is a public-private partnership. I think if you compare the amount of money, for example in the U.S., that we spend on national security, on defending ourselves from the threats of foreign powers who may seek to use weapons against us, traditional weapons, we spend a lot of money hoping that we'll never have to use it. We don't want to have to use those bombs or those bombers or those jet fighters or those missiles, but we think it's imperative that we have them to defend ourselves. And yet with respect to ensuring health security, we do the opposite. We don't ensure that we can secure, as Mike was saying, our health care systems. We want to run our hospitals as lean and as efficiently as we possibly can. We want to actually spend money on the things that are challenges today and not spend money on the threats of emerging infectious diseases. And I don't mean just potentially pandemic influenza and other viruses, but what about drug-resistant bacteria? You know, here we continue to invest a lot of money in AMR issues. The reality of the world is there is no good business model for those things. You want to develop new products that will be useful against drug-resistant bacteria, but you know, it actually defeats the general model that we have in this industry of wanting to have rapid and high uptake of new drugs. So that we can make money on the volume of it. Here you want to actually, if you can, reserve these new life-saving medicines for those people who need them. And the toll that these sort of superbug infections right now are taking on hospitalized patients is really great. And I've seen data that says that more people in 2050 will die from resistant forms of bacteria than from cancer. And yet we're not investing in that at all. So I'm very much worried that while we focus a lot on spending money on weapons for quote national security, and even a significant amount on domestic security, we don't really recognize health security in the same way.

Much of the comments that the three of you have made are emphasizing equity, emphasizing health rather than sickness, emphasizing inclusion. If you again go to that sort of long-term period, how do you think about public health and how to push on some of those forces that push companies or academic medical centers away from public health and towards sickness care? Do you have ideas about how from a policy and public sentiment that could change? Many of the questions we're getting from the audience have to do with that inequality, diversity, and clinical trials. And I would put a lot of what's been said under the rubric of public health, and yet public health, especially when we're not in a pandemic, doesn't get a lot of publicity or attention.
B
Betsy Nabel37:35
You know, it's interesting, Sue. We think a lot about value-based healthcare. And I'd be really curious to see what Ken and Michelle think about it from your vantage point. The way that we think about it is that we need to lower the cost of care to consumers. We call it lowering total medical expense, but it's really lowering the cost of care. And how do we do that? It's by engaging in more preventive work, more community-based work, delivering care at the appropriate setting, reducing the amount of care that's delivered in high-cost academic medical centers. And it's really developing an entirely new workforce that is home-based, office-based, telemedicine-based, community-based. And with that, we found during COVID, you might find this curious, but I bought five RVs and we equipped them with testing and educational materials, and we took them out into various communities in Boston because our city simply didn't have the resources or the talent to do community-based testing, contact tracing, and education, multilingual education. And so we did that as a strategy to educate and test early to prevent subsequent infections and hospitalizations. So I think of public health not as a separate discipline, but I think of it as a continuum of care. And it's the care we have to deliver in the community very early on to educate folks, help them learn to take care of themselves, their families, their loved ones, deal with whatever insecurities they have, food insecurities, housing insecurities. And to me, that is one of the ways in which we at the end of the day are going to lower the cost of care to all of us in this country.

Do you think that this is the same potential kind of moment as it is domestically, globally, that we could actually change the way that we think and the industry or public-private partnerships could start to address global health needs?
K
Ken Frazier46:56
So let me say that I want to say yes, but I don't believe it. Our experience is that there's an ultra nationalism that's taking over. I think it's exemplified in some ways, and I don't want to be political, by what's happening in the U.S. with the sort of America First ethos. We're seeing that countries in Europe are trying to say let's make sure that our populations get them first. I recognize that there are a lot of forces for goodwill. You know, Sue just recently was at the Gates Foundation; they've done an awful lot in this area. There are a lot of organizations in the world, CEPI and others, who are trying to make sure that we get these vaccines to the people who need them. But let's take a step back and realize that there's seven and a half billion people on the planet. I don't think we've ever had to contend with something that was truly a global pandemic. If you think about vaccines in terms of volume, I think the biggest vaccines in terms of volume have to be influenza seasonal influenza vaccines, and we make less than two billion of them. And we have seven and a half billion people in the world to deal with. And we have to think about the difficulty of distributing these innovations, these life-saving innovations, to the people, including the last mile, in places that have been neglected up until now. I think this is a big challenge. And I think there's a certain amount of, it goes, there's an enormous rhetorical appeal to saying that we care about everyone in the world and we care about everyone equally, but it is just rhetoric at this point. As you know, Mike, because you were here at Merck when we did the Mectizan program, you know, we're going to be giving the award to Bill Fagan tonight, and so Bill has been a hero. But just think about how challenging it was to deal with river blindness in sub-Saharan Africa, and we're talking about one pill per person per year. Compare and contrast that with distributing vaccines that have to be kept in a cold chain to people all over the world. So I just think this is one of those things that if the rich countries in the world don't really, really come together and provide help along with great organizations like the Gates Foundation, we won't be getting these medicines to the people in the parts of the world who need them anytime soon.

Yeah, let me ask the group something parochial about our industry. You know, we've made over the certainly the 50 years of Galien great contributions to health. And we make them, and then there's public amnesia about what was done, and the reputation goes back to the same unfortunate for us low point. We've had the polio vaccine, we've had statins, we've transformed AIDS, Ebola. And I think we're about to make comparable inventions to alter the course of the coronavirus. And do you think it's going to be the same thing now, that we'll do something great and then people will forget about it and go back to the reputation that they're most comfortable with, or do you think this is a moment where it'll change? And are we doing the right things to change it?
K
Ken Frazier54:55
So may I just take a shot at that? I hope it is the moment of change, but I think my industry has to be willing to engage in self-examination. It wasn't that long ago when this industry was referred to, not tongue-in-cheek, as the ethical pharmaceutical industry, and a company like Merck could be most admired for seven or eight years in a row in the Fortune survey. But a lot of things happened. And you know, we've talked about climate change a couple of times, and I'd like to make an analogy. You know, if you're in the oil and gas business, you know that the world needs more hydrocarbons as people come into the middle class in order for them to have lifestyles that they need and want to have. We're going to need even more hydrocarbons. But from a shared value perspective, we also see that the environment is being destroyed. So at the same time that there's more of a demand for those hydrocarbons, there's a concern about greenhouse gases. And I think in that same shared value analogy, with all the great achievements of our industry that have expanded human life in a great way, you know, what we're seeing with cancer, what we saw with HIV, what we're seeing with infectious disease, what Michelle is going to do with Alzheimer's disease very soon, those are all wonderful things. But in a shared value framework, the question of affordability is a real issue for our industry, just as the issue of the environment is for the people in the oil and gas industry. And I think sometimes we haven't focused on that. We haven't focused on the fact that access and affordability are the issues that cause people to really frown upon our industry, notwithstanding all the contributions we've made. So I'm sort of tempted to say something that I would say to my kids when they were growing up, which is we don't want you to have a good reputation, we want you to have a good character. Because if you have a good character, your reputation will flow from it. And I do think that this industry has to think about that shared value issue of how we get our life-saving medicines and vaccines to all the people who need it.
